The Challenge
J. Goldin was a new luxury eyewear brand with no existing product line or supply chain. The task was to design an entire inaugural collection from scratch, ensuring it reflected the vision of a modern luxury brand while achieving small-batch production standards in Italy.
The Process
Concept Development: Created mood boards, color palettes, and design inspiration that aligned with the brand’s mission and aesthetic. Created initial design sketches identifying shapes, silhouettes, and patterns coming from an informed dive into current fashion trends.
Technical Design: Produced detailed tech packs/spec sheets, including measurements, material specs, construction notes and colorways. Created to-scale technical drawings in Adobe Illustrator and 3D CAD models in Rhino.
Prototyping: Selected colorways, sourced materials, and oversaw prototype development with Italian manufacturers.
Supply Chain: Researched and established production partners capable of small-batch luxury runs, and managed sample review cycles through to final approval.
Final Delivery: Directed the process through to production-ready frames, ensuring each piece balanced innovation, craftsmanship, and luxury positioning.
Outcome
The inaugural collection was solo designed by me, setting the design DNA for J. Goldin. It established the brand as a serious contender in the luxury eyewear space, defined by bold silhouettes, refined details, and artisanal small-batch quality.
